Default What type of chip in in my key?

long story short. I ordered 2 key fobs with keys. Keys are cut and unlock everything, however the small glass tube chip is wrong. what is the make and model of the chip I need? Looks like I can change it fairly easily. (2006 X-Type Wagon.)

Texas Crypto 4D60

Not being sure what you have, it may be the right chip and just need the car to be programmed to accept the code. Each transponder has a unique code, except for those which are "cloned" from another chip.

If the key fob is working to unlock trunk, unlock/lock doors, it is the correct Mhz key fob. The "glass pellet" in the fob needs programing to your car = car will not start using the new fob. ​​​​​​​SEARCH will return where/how//who can provide this programming.
